spark knock

I have a 1998 F-150 with a 4.6l v8 110,000 miles. When going up hills the engine knocks. The only thing that gets rid of it is high octane fuel. I questioned the guy at advance auto and a customer behind me overheard and told me it was my coil pack. Could this be true? I thought they worked or they didnt.

One thing to try to help out. Remove EGR and thottle body elbow/neck. Clean the Egr and the port in the throttle elbow completely. Also has your check engine light been coming on?

most likely the EGR is not flowing enough. Possible knock sensor, some 4.6's had them, is bad
